What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ry refers to psychiatric services offered outside the general public health care system. Patients can seek treatment from private psychiatrists through direct payment or health insurance protection. These specialists are medical doctors concentrating on mental health disorders, capable of diagnosing and treating a spectrum of conditions, from anxiety and depression to more severe conditions like schizophrenia and bipolar illness.

FAQs About Private Psychiatry
Does insurance cover private psychiatry?
Many insurance plans provide some coverage for private psychiatrist sees, but the level of this protection differs. It's vital to talk to both the insurance supplier and the psychiatrist's workplace before scheduling a consultation.
What qualifications should I search for in a private psychiatrist?
Patients must guarantee that their psychiatrist is board-certified in psychiatry, has relevant experience in their area of issue, and possesses a good connection with them.
How do I find a private psychiatrist?
Clients can seek recommendations from medical care doctors, search online directories, or utilize mental health expert associations to find certified psychiatrists in their area.
What should I expect during my first visit?
Anticipate a preliminary assessment that consists of background information about your mental health history, current signs, and treatment goals. Be prepared to discuss your feelings freely.
